Tools You'll Need

Before you start taking off a tire, you need to make sure you have the right tools. Here are the essential tools you'll need:

1. Jack and Jack Stands

You'll need a jack to lift your car and a jack stand to keep it secure while you remove the tire. Make sure the jack and jack stand are rated for the weight of your vehicle.

2. Lug Wrench

A lug wrench is used to loosen and tighten the lug nuts that hold the tire in place. Make sure you have the right size lug wrench for your vehicle.

3. Wheel Chocks

Wheel chocks are used to prevent your car from rolling while you're working on it. Place them on the opposite side of the tire you're removing.

Step-by-Step Guide to Taking Off a Tire

Now that you have the right tools, let's get started on how to take off a tire:

Step 1: Park Your Car on a Flat Surface

Make sure your car is on a level surface and engage the parking brake. Place the wheel chocks on the opposite side of the tire you're removing.

Step 2: Loosen the Lug Nuts

Using the lug wrench, loosen the lug nuts on the tire you're removing. Don't remove them completely, just loosen them enough so you can easily remove them later.

Step 3: Lift the Car with the Jack

Position the jack under the designated jacking point on your car. Use the jack to lift your car until the tire is off the ground. Make sure the jack is secure and stable.

Step 4: Secure the Car with Jack Stands

Place the jack stands under the designated jacking points on your car. Slowly lower the car onto the jack stands. Make sure the car is secure and stable before removing the jack.

Step 5: Remove the Lug Nuts and Tire

Using the lug wrench, remove the lug nuts from the tire you're removing. Once the lug nuts are removed, gently pull the tire off the wheel hub.

Tips and Tricks

Here are a few tips and tricks to make taking off a tire even easier:

1. Use a Penetrating Oil

If the lug nuts are rusted or stuck, spray them with a penetrating oil like WD-40 or PB Blaster. This will help loosen them up and make them easier to remove.

2. Use a Torque Wrench

When you're tightening the lug nuts back onto the wheel hub, use a torque wrench to make sure they're tightened to the proper torque specifications. This will ensure that the tire is properly secured.

3. Keep Your Tires Balanced

When you're rotating your tires, make sure to have them balanced afterwards. Unbalanced tires can cause vibrations and uneven wear, which can be dangerous.
